Jerk Chicken Recipe

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s
  • 2 tablespoons ground allspice
  • 2 tablespoons dried thyme
  • 1 tablespoon cayenne pepper
  • 1 tablespoon ground sage
  • 3/4 tablespoon ground nutmeg
  • 3/4 tablespoon ground cinnamon
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 4 garlic cloves, finely chopped
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 1/2 cup vinegar
  • 1/2 cup orange juice
  • 1 lime, juiced
  • 1 scotch bonnet pepper, chopped (or habaneros)
  • 1/2 cup olive oil
  • 1/2 cup white onion, chopped
  • 3 green onions, chopped

Cooking instructions

  1. In a large bowl, combine all the spices, salt, pepper, garlic, sugar, soy sauce, vinegar, orange juice, lime juice, scotch bonnet pepper, olive oil, white onion, and green onions. Whisk together to form the jerk marinade.
  2. Place the chicken thighs in the marinade and ensure they are fully coated.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ight for best flavor.
  3.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  4. Remove the chicken from the marinade, letting excess drip off. Place the chicken on the grill. Grill for about 6-7 minutes per side, or until the chicken is cooked through and the skin is crispy and charred.
  5. Let the chicken rest for a few minutes before serving.
